Enhancing animal health and welfare: WOAH launches The Animal Echo

In a rapidly evolving world where the health of humans, animals, and the environment are intricately connected, addressing animal health and welfare has never been more critical.

Recognising this, the World Organisation for Animal Health (WOAH) has introduced The Animal Echo, an innovative online space aimed at fostering global knowledge sharing to tackle pressing global challenges through the lens of animal health.

A vision for global collaboration

The Animal Echo is designed as a dynamic, collaborative knowledge-sharing platform that brings together insights from experts across various fields.

It seeks to enhance the understanding of animal health and welfare while advancing solutions to global health challenges.

Whether you’re a veterinary professional, a policymaker, or simply passionate about animal welfare, The Animal Echo promises to be a hub of valuable information tailored to diverse interests and professions.

This platform reflects WOAH’s commitment to addressing the interconnected challenges of food security, biodiversity loss, climate change, public health, and global trade through the lens of animal health.

It also emphasises that the health of animals is directly tied to human well-being and environmental sustainability.

Why improving animal health matters

Improving animal health isn’t just about preventing disease – it’s about creating a healthier world. Here’s why this issue demands global attention:

Safeguarding public health

Animals play a pivotal role in human health. Zoonotic diseases, which can be transmitted between animals and humans, account for approximately 60% of all infectious diseases.

By improving animal health, we reduce the risk of outbreaks that could impact millions of lives, such as avian influenza or rabies.

Protecting biodiversity

Healthy animal populations are crucial to maintaining ecosystems. From pollinators that support agriculture to predators that regulate populations, animals ensure the stability of biodiversity.

Addressing issues like habitat destruction and wildlife diseases helps protect these ecosystems and, in turn, the planet.

Strengthening food security

Livestock health directly impacts food supply chains. Diseases in livestock not only lead to economic losses but can also threaten food security, particularly in regions heavily reliant on agriculture.

Ensuring animal welfare safeguards these vital resources and promotes sustainable agricultural practices.

Fostering economic growth

The global economy depends significantly on animals – whether through livestock, trade, or tourism. Healthy animals mean fewer disruptions in these industries, enabling countries to grow economically while meeting international standards of animal welfare.

Mitigating climate change

The relationship between animals and climate change is multifaceted. On the one hand, livestock contribute to greenhouse gas emissions; on the other, their health is directly impacted by climate shifts.

By improving animal health practices, we can better manage these challenges, promoting sustainability and resilience.
